Dear Friends,

I am doing stress analysis for a pipe line usign ASME 31.4 design code. While executing the model i observed some errors. Error states that the Temperature (135 c) is outside the allowable range for this material but when i decrease the tempreature to (100 c) there was no error. I tried for another pipe line model with same material and operating parameters (135 c) and different diameter and i found no errors.

The pipe Material is API 5L Gr. B. I also have attached the error file. Plz advice me.

I would guess that B31.4 does not supply either the coefficient of expansion or yield stress above 100C.

You can edit the material database to see.

You can edit the database or you can provide the missing data explicitly.

Verify the material data in the material database for the combination of: your piping code(s), your temperature(s), and your material(s). If anything is out of range, you will have problems.
